A Bunch of Moving House Tactics You May Not Have Contemplated

The world wide web is filled with generic moving guidelines, moving house secrets, moving house dough saving and moving words and phrases of reinforcement for movers, but it’s usually the standard stuff. Obtain a moving log; prep far ahead of time; make sure you help keep your most loved trinkets safe and sound with a bit more padding; label this, brand this; have a moving company…it is almost endless, it is generic and you really should realise it all by now. In this article, we’ll try our very best to get away from all those things and submit a couple of distinctive ideas which you may not yet have thought of.

Get the youngsters, family pets and infirm far away when you need to do your packing. That is a critical word of advice. Children are going to either get under your feet or hate the whole thing (no one wants to leave the house they have grown up in), and it'll be worthwhile whisking them off and away to a baby sitter for a short period of time as you get down to it. Creatures ditto, they’ll simply get beneath your toes, and may be hazardous to be about when you’re shifting the weighty goods.

It might appear a touch over the top, but contemplate hosting a moving house get together. Tell every one of your close friends, lay on a bit of a feed, a bit (but not a lot or your things are getting broken) of alcohol and you might discover you’ve got loads of willing attendees/un paid employees to help you along with your move. You’ll be happy just how many will come out, and the more of you there are, the easier it can all be. Bring them in on the packing up period and treat them nicely and you may discover the very same individuals appearing when it comes time to moving too. Honestly, your mates will want to help you out, and this could save you a substantial amount of money when it comes time to working out any cost.

For all the short period, brief commitment renters, it might be time for you to dump the inferior quality, begged, acquired and disparate home furniture. If you’re not moving to a fully furnished house, and you’re planning on buying even more pieces of furniture, moving it all, waiting around for it to get sent, and storing it if you ever transfer to a furnished property next time around, then there could just be a solution. Furniture rental is really a first-rate approach for temporary renter's; cost-effective and extremely handy, you get it as it's needed and it's collected when you’re finished with it, all at a fraction of the expense of an full-scale investment. Even better, try and encourage your property manager to get a landlord furniture package for a little supplementary rent money every month and you will both be pleased.

Be tough, totally and definitely brutal with regards to what you need to move. You aren't going to do your self any favors by packing the cutlery that has not been utilized in 5 years or the old bedding that you consigned to your storage a long time ago. The same applies for solid fixings too. Got a chair you don’t think would compliment the new house, have a handful of trinkets your significant other can’t stand and you think cute, have something that’s ruined but you keep telling your self you’ll get around to mending them before long? Trash them. In fact, bin anything you will be able to, as it'll help you immeasurably now, and if not now, then a touch in the future once you understand you don’t know the way to fix them. After all there are many individuals seeking this kind of furniture, and that means you could just place it on a free site and also have someone remove it for you.
